Microchip Technology's 24LC08BH-E/SN EEPROM
The 24LC08BH-E/SN is a high-performance, 8-Kilobit serial Electrically Erasable Programmable Read-Only Memory (EEPROM) device from the renowned Microchip Technology. Designed with versatility in mind, this EEPROM module is an ideal solution for advanced data storage applications where low power consumption and reliable data retention are crucial.
This particular EEPROM operates in the standard I2C (Inter-Integrated Circuit) bus, making it easily interfaced with a vast array of microcontrollers and processors. The 24LC08BH-E/SN offers a flexible organization of 1024 x 8 bits, allowing for efficient storage and retrieval of configuration settings, calibration data, and various user-specific information.
One of the key features of the 24LC08BH-E/SN is its wide voltage range, operating from 2.5V to 5.5V. This makes it suitable for both 3.3V and 5V systems, providing designers with the flexibility to use it across different platforms and applications. The device also boasts a low-power design, ensuring minimal power consumption during both active and standby modes, which is particularly beneficial for battery-operated devices.
The 24LC08BH-E/SN comes in a compact 8-pin SOIC package, making it easy to integrate into space-constrained designs. It supports a bidirectional data transfer protocol, which increases the efficiency of the communication process and allows for higher data throughput.
With its built-in error correction and a high endurance of one million write cycles, the 24LC08BH-E/SN ensures data integrity and a long operational lifespan. The device's data retention is rated for more than 200 years, providing peace of mind for applications that require long-term data storage.
